    What kind of upgrade are you looking for? Their wraparounds are pretty awesome. The only feasible upgrades a sandwich MIGHT do is a Lanai or Two Bedroom City Suite which IMO are not any better than a wraparound. Lanai is actually pretty small compared to a Wraparound and the Two Bedroom has no terrace.

    The sandwich can definitely help with a better view of the Bellagio Fountains and/or a higher floor. So as far as the amount, I'd actually start by just being friendly and politely asking for an upgraded view since you already have a wraparound, otherwise, a $20 should suffice since you're really only asking for a better view.
